diff --git a/docs/plans/api-stabilization.md b/docs/plans/api-stabilization.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..be9b28d --- /dev/null +++ b/docs/plans/api-stabilization.md @@ -0,0 +1,186 @@ +# PLAN: sukr 1.0 API Stabilization + + + +## Goal + +Implement the pre-1.0 API changes required to stabilize sukr's public contract: switch frontmatter from hand-rolled YAML to serde-backed TOML, normalize template variable naming, add missing features (draft mode, 404 page, tag listing pages, aliases, date validation, feed/sitemap config), remove dead code, and add template fallback behavior. After this work, the five public surfaces (site.toml schema, frontmatter fields, template variables, CLI, content directory conventions) are locked — post-1.0 breaking changes require explicit user approval. + +## Constraints + +- Pre-1.0: breaking changes are acceptable now but the goal is to make them unnecessary after this work +- Suckless philosophy: no speculative features, no new dependencies unless already transitively present +- `tree-house` (git dep) and `lightningcss` (alpha) are accepted risks — do not attempt to resolve +- `chrono` is acceptable for date validation — it's already a transitive dependency via `tera` +- Every surface stabilized is a surface committed to maintaining + +## Decisions + +| Decision | Choice | Rationale | +| :--------------------- | :------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| :-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| +| Frontmatter format | **TOML** (replacing hand-rolled YAML) | `toml` crate + serde already in deps. Eliminates the fragile hand-rolled parser. Every future field is just a struct field with `#[derive(Deserialize)]`. | +| Frontmatter delimiter | `+++` | Hugo convention for TOML frontmatter. Unambiguous — no risk of confusion with YAML `---` or Markdown horizontal rules. | +| Template naming | Mirror site.toml structure (`config.nav.nested` not `config.nested_nav`) | Consistency between config and templates; pre-1.0 is only window for this break | +| Date type | Validate as YYYY-MM-DD string via `chrono::NaiveDate`, keep as `String` in template context | Validate at parse time; reject invalid formats. Feed generation already assumes this format. | +| Draft filtering | `draft: bool` (`#[serde(default)]`) in `Frontmatter`, filter in `collect_items()` and `discover()` | Filter early so drafts don't appear in nav, listings, sitemap, or feed. | +| Feed/sitemap config | `[feed]` and `[sitemap]` tables with `enabled` boolean in `SiteConfig` | Users need opt-out. Default `true` preserves backward compat. | +| Tag listing pages | Generate `/tags/.html` using a new `tags/default.html` template | Minimal approach — one template, one generation loop. No pagination. | +| Aliases | `aliases = ["/old/path"]` in frontmatter, generate HTML redirect stubs | Standard pattern (Hugo). `` redirect. | +| 404 page | `content/404.md` → `404.html` at output root | Simplest approach. Most static hosts auto-serve `/404.html`. | +| Template fallback | Try `section/.html`, fall back to `section/default.html` | Removes the requirement to create a template for every section_type. | +| Dead template cleanup | Delete `section/features.html` and `homepage.html` | Byte-for-byte duplicate and dead code respectively. | +| `base_url` duplication | Remove top-level `base_url` template variable | Single source of truth via `config.base_url`. | +| Tags syntax | `tags = ["foo", "bar"]` (flat TOML array) | Replaces nested `taxonomies.tags` YAML. Simpler, no indirection. | + +## Risks & Assumptions + +| Risk / Assumption | Severity | Status | Mitigation / Evidence | +| :------------------------------------------------------ | :------- | :---------- | :------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| +| TOML frontmatter breaks all 17 existing content files | **HIGH** | Validated | One-time mechanical migration. All files are simple key-value; no complex structures. Migration is part of Phase 1. | +| Documentation pages embed YAML frontmatter examples | MEDIUM | Validated | `configuration.md`, `content-organization.md`, `getting-started.md`, `feeds.md`, `sections.md`, `sitemap.md`, `templates.md` all contain example frontmatter in their body text. Must update these doc examples too. | +| Template naming break affects existing user templates | MEDIUM | Validated | Only `docs/templates/base.html` references `config.nested_nav` and `base_url`. The docs site is the only known deployment. | +| Tag listing pages need a template but no default ships | MEDIUM | Unvalidated | Must design and ship `tags/default.html` in `docs/templates/`. | +| `collect_items()` triple-call not fixed by this plan | LOW | Accepted | Performance issue, not API concern. Deferred. | +| Removing `base_url` top-level variable breaks templates | MEDIUM | Validated | Only `docs/templates/base.html` uses it. | + +## Open Questions + +All resolved during CHALLENGE. See CHALLENGE Notes below. + +### CHALLENGE Notes + +Items presented to nrd for decision: + +1. **YAML → TOML frontmatter switch.** The hand-rolled YAML parser can't handle `aliases` lists. Rather than extending a fragile parser, nrd decided to switch frontmatter to TOML — the `toml` crate and serde are already dependencies. This eliminates the parser entirely and replaces 70 lines of hand-rolled code with `#[derive(Deserialize)]`. **Decision: switch to TOML.** + +Items validated by codebase investigation: + +2. **`ConfigContext` normalization is clean.** Flat struct at `template_engine.rs:139-155`. Refactoring to nested `nav: NavContext { nested, toc }` is straightforward. +3. **`base_url` duplication confirmed.** `template_engine.rs:118` injects standalone `base_url`. `ConfigContext.base_url` at line 142 is canonical. Removal safe. +4. **Template variable `content` is correct.** Lines 57 and 83 inject rendered HTML as `content`, matching the sketch contract. +5. **Phase ordering is sound.** No circular dependencies between phases. +6. **17 content files need migration.** All simple frontmatter — no nested structures beyond `taxonomies.tags` (which becomes flat `tags = [...]`). 7 files also contain embedded YAML examples in body text that need updating. + +## Scope + +### In Scope + +1. **TOML frontmatter switch** — replace hand-rolled YAML parser with `#[derive(Deserialize)]` + `toml::from_str`, migrate 17 content files, change delimiter from `---` to `+++` +2.
